Morning: Start your trip in the bustling city of Delhi. Visit the iconic Red Fort and explore its historical significance. In the afternoon, head to Akshardham Temple, a stunning architectural marvel. As the evening sets in, take a leisurely walk in Lodhi Garden and admire the beautiful monuments.
Morning: Travel to Amritsar, known for its rich Sikh heritage. Visit the Golden Temple, a spiritual and architectural masterpiece. In the afternoon, explore the Jallianwala Bagh memorial to learn about India's struggle for independence. Enjoy the evening ceremony at Wagah Border, a fascinating display of the India-Pakistan border closing ceremony.
Morning: Travel to Dalhousie, a charming hill station nestled in the Himalayas. Enjoy a leisurely walk at Subhash Baoli and soak in the serene atmosphere. In the afternoon, visit Khajjiar, often referred to as the "Mini Switzerland of India," and enjoy horse riding and panoramic views of the landscape. Spend the evening exploring the local markets.
Morning: Travel to Kullu, known for its beautiful valleys and adventure activities. Enjoy river rafting on the Beas River and experience the thrill of the rapids. In the afternoon, visit the famous Raghunath Temple and seek blessings. Take a scenic walk along the river in the evening.
Morning: Proceed to Manali, a popular hill station known for its scenic beauty and adventure sports. Visit Hadimba Devi Temple and seek blessings. In the afternoon, explore the picturesque Solang Valley and indulge in thrilling activities like paragliding and zorbing. Enjoy the evening at Mall Road, the main shopping and dining area.
Morning: Proceed to Shimla, the capital of Himachal Pradesh and a popular hill station. Take a walk on Mall Road and visit the famous Christ Church. In the afternoon, explore the beautiful Jakhu Hill and enjoy panoramic views from the top. Spend the evening at The Ridge, a popular open space.
Morning: Enjoy your last morning in Shimla by exploring the Shimla Heritage Museum to learn about the city's colonial history. In the afternoon, catch your flight back home from Delhi.

In Delhi, take a walk through the narrow lanes of Chandni Chowk and savor the delicious street food. In Amritsar, try the local specialty, Amritsari Kulcha, at popular food joints. In Shimla, take a short trek to the scenic Glen Forest and enjoy a picnic amidst nature. These experiences will provide a unique and memorable travel experience for the whole family.
